Alex Vindman, Impeachment Witness, Runs for Senate in Florida

7 reported

Alex Vindman, who testified during President Donald Trump’s first impeachment trial in 2019, is running for the U.S. Senate in Florida. Vindman announced his candidacy in January to challenge Republican incumbent Ashley Moody for the seat previously held by Marco Rubio. He moved to Florida in 2023 because his wife wanted to escape politics. Vindman served as director for European affairs on the National Security Council and retired from the Army in 2020 after being ousted from the NSC. He describes his campaign as a new chapter of service, focusing on issues like affordability and corruption in Florida. Vindman has criticized his opponent for supporting the war in Iran and for voting to block congressional oversight of military force. He stated that Senator Moody still leads in most polls but that he is often within close range.
